Main Rd, Gokalpuri, , Delhi - 110094, Delhi, India
Shop no-41-44, mangolpuri, , Delhi - 110083, Delhi, India
W 104, Part 2, New Delhi, , Delhi - 110001, Delhi, India
12/15, Reghar Pura, Karol Bagh, , Delhi - 110005, Delhi, India
Lal Kaun, Main MB Road, Pul Prahladpur, , Delhi - 110044, Delhi, India